    Originally Posted by rexie
    1 box yellow cake mix
    1 can mandarin oranges
    4 eggs
    1/2 c. oil
    1 (3 oz.) pkg. vanilla instant pudding
    1 (15 oz.) can crushed pineapple with juice
    1 (12 oz.) carton Cool Whip

    Preheat oven to 325'. Mix cake mix, oranges, eggs and oil. Pour batter into a prepared pan. Bake for 30 minutes. Cool cake. Combine pudding mix, pineapple with juice and Cool Whip. Spread on cake liberally. Keep cake refrigerated.
